#1b1ecf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1b1ecf is composed of 10.6% red, 11.8% green and 81.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87% cyan, 85.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 239 degrees, a saturation of 76.9% and a lightness of 45.9%. #1b1ecf color hex could be obtained by blending #363cff with #00009f.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

Shades and Tints of #1b1ecf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020210 is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#1b1ecf

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#757575 is the less saturated color, while #090de1 is the most saturated one.
